--- Comment #6 from Eike Rathke <erack at redhat.com> 2012-07-03 14:01:10 UTC ---
During interpret for B10 the ScFormulaResult::GetMatrixFormulaCellToken() in
ScFormulaCell::GetMatColsRows() returns a formula::svHybridCell, hence the
nCols and nRows are 0 and a 1x0 matrix is created in ScInterpreter::GetNewMat()
from ScInterpreter::ScRow()

The following calls to ScInterpreter::ScMatRef() for B11:B30 then of course
don't find a valid positional offset in the matrix in B10
